About this map

Catskill Park defines the high-elevation landscape of this mid-century survey, with the Woodstock township serving as a cultural and residential hub in the valley. The map documents a traditional rural infrastructure of numbered school districts, such as School No 5 near Lake Hill and School No 3 south of Bearsville. These points of assembly, along with the settlement at Byrdcliffe, reflect the established community patterns before modern suburban expansion.
